Ruthern Valley, Cornwall

Close to Bodmin Moor, this secluded little camp is an idyllic escape for all the family. There are woods for making dens, beaches for building sandcastles, pigs and chickens to feed, and bikes that you can hire to ride along a nearby track. Ruthern Valley, Tel: 01208 831395

We have stayed at some great campsites in France and most of them are listed on the following review site : www.bestfrenchcampsites.com

The ones we liked best were St Cast le Chatelet for its great beach although the cliff path can be avoided with small children - its possible to go via the road to the beach and I think there may be a short cut another way as well avoiding the cliff path.

We also like La Baie at Trinite Sur Mer as there is lots to see around Carnac.  And finally Les Deux Fontaines was a lovely quiet campsite with lots of space for kids to run around, two good playparks - one is hidden in a field ! and a nice swimming pool.

We didnt camp abroad until the youngest was about 4 as it can be tricky even in a mobile home keepiing an eye on them. Best tip is to arrange the sunloungers etc to create a garden area to fence them in !  We have also camped in tents with children. Best tip there is to take some old doormats to arrange at the door to trap the mud as its being walked towards the tent !
